Maine in November?

I'll be heading up to Maine for a long weekend before Thanksgiving? Any suggestions on what to do and where to go in the mid-coast region would be greatly appreciated. We'll be in the Boothbay/Damariscotta/Wiscasset area - looking for restaurants, activities and most importantly, where to procure a lobster roll. Thanks so much!

Hands down Red's in Wiscasset is most famous for Lobster Rolls. I am not sure if they are seasonal or not. It may be a bit sleepy on the coast in Nov. but you will have the beautiful beaches to yourselves.
